Starbucks Starbucks

Are you an owner of this business, venue or place? Claim your listing and attract more visitors. 

Starbucks

80 Briggate, Leeds, LS1 6LQ, United Kingdom | 0113 242 6550 | Website
HannahMcGurk

HannahMcGurk

Leeds, UK

25
13 likes

13

2.5

Starbucks is a big chain, so you know what you're getting - which can be good for planning for some people. The venue is accessible, although the doors to get in are quite heavy and not automati...

1 result shown

Visited this
venue before?

Write Your Review

We've had 1 review for Starbucks

1 2